Coventry to Shoeburyness by train

A train trip from Coventry to Shoeburyness takes about 4hrs 38 mins on average, covering roughly 115 miles (185 kilometres). With around 33 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£12.50,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Coventry to Shoeburyness start from as little as £12.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Coventry to Shoeburyness start from £57.80 one way, or £60.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Coventry to Shoeburyness are available for £98.20 one way, or £160.30 return

Facilities and Amenities

When it comes to purchasing tickets at Coventry station, accessibility and convenience are paramount. With a ticket office open from Monday to Friday starting at 5:15 AM and accessible ticket machines, travelers can easily collect tickets bought online. The station supports smartcard validators, although it doesn't issue smartcards itself. Help and support are readily available with information from staff, screen announcements, and customer help points strategically placed on platforms. For lost property and assistance, services align through Avanti West Coast, and there's omnipresent CCTV ensuring safety.

Accessibility is a strong point at Coventry station: it boasts step-free access across all platforms, making rail travel hassle-free for all passengers. Waiting areas are spread across the concourse and platforms, along with heated waiting rooms and unheated seating. Essential amenities like accessible toilets and baby changing facilities ensure a balanced mix of comfort and utility. With 336 parking spaces available in the multi-story car park, including 16 accessible spaces, you can park and ride easily.

Station Facilities and Services

Shoeburyness station is designed with passenger convenience and accessibility in mind. Ticket purchasing is a breeze with an on-site ticket office open during morning hours, while ticket machines are available 24/7 for both purchases and the collection of tickets bought online. Travellers will appreciate the step-free access throughout the station, ensuring ease of movement from the street level to all platforms.

While the station does not boast a waiting room or refreshment facilities, there are accessible toilets on Platforms 2 and 3, including baby changing amenities and National key toilets operated by a RADAR key. For peace of mind, CCTV is active both in the station and car park. If you are cycling in, there’s sheltered bicycle storage with CCTV coverage adjacent to the station building. Plus, Shoeburyness fosters connectivity with public Wi-Fi and pay phones installed.
